Day 5 - A Selection of Crystals and Gemstones

When contemplating which gemstones and crystals to use for yesterday's "Sorrow" card, I was confronted with the idea that its meaning could represent a variety of different things. It could suggest emotional conflict just as easily as it could represent the end of a business relationship. Therefore, I took a look at which crystals and gems are the most readily available and have the most ability to be used for multiple purposes. In fact, most crystals and gems have multiple uses which make it easy to begin collecting and using them in your daily life.


Copyright - Green Earth Stones

Amethyst - One of the most common specimens, Amethyst has been used since Ancient times as both a talisman and a sign of royalty. Amethyst has the ability to both calm and soothe while transforming murky energy into positive energy. It is usually associated with the Brow or Third Eye Chakra.





Copyright - Green Earth Stones

Rose Quartz - Typically associated with the Heart Chakra for its ability to purify. It helps us open to receiving love and heals our darker emotions that come about from anger, resentment, and hurt. Another readily available stone, you can wear it as jewelry or use it in a gem elixir.





Copyright - Green Earth Stones


Smoky Quartz - Neutralizes negative vibrations and helps to ground and center those who meditate with it. Smoky Quartz is a great addition to crystal grids because of its energetic properties. Resonates with the Base Chakra.





Copyright - Green Earth Stones

Selenite - One of my new personal favorites, Selenite carries a high vibration and powerfully disperses and stabilizes negative emotions. It is frequently purchased in wand form for cleaning the aura, though I have also seen it in pyramids and towers. It can be easily placed in a room or around the house.

Challenge - Day 1: Abundance

To those of you that have not yet seen my video for the 7-Day Oracle Challenge that I'm taking part in, click the YouTube link above and you will be taken directly to my videos.




The first card was "Wealth."

According to the Shapeshifter Tarot guide book, drawing this card "represents a time for investing in property, a house, or starting a new business. Through communication and organization, it becomes the optimum time to manifest abundance into your life. Material prosperity, lineage, and family honor, as well as good investment gain, riches, or inheritance may come to the seeker in the near future." This card typically corresponds with the Ten of Pentacles in standard tarot decks.
